Wikipedia Overview

The campaign against spiritual pollution, or Anti-Spiritual Pollution Campaign, was a political campaign spearheaded by conservative factions within the Chinese Communist Party that lasted from October 1983 to January 1984. In general, its advocates wanted to curb Western-inspired liberal ideas among the Chinese populace, a by-product of the nascent reform and opening up and the "New Enlightenment" movement which began in 1978.
